Allergy Physician sits within the Allergy & Immunology NUCC taxonomy group and currently counts 1,017 individual clinicians enrolled in the CMS National Plan and Provider Enumeration System across 50 U.S. states and territories. The NUCC taxonomy is the industry-standard code set CMS uses to classify provider specialties on Medicare and Medicaid claims, and each provider selects their primary taxonomy at NPI enrollment — so this count reflects how many clinicians self-identify their primary practice as Allergy Physician rather than a census of every professional who ever trained in the field. Dual-certified practitioners who registered under a different primary code will not appear in this total.
Geographic distribution is uneven across the 50-state footprint. California holds the largest concentration with 162 Allergy Physician providers (15.9% of the national total), followed by New York at 105 (10.3%) and Texas at 72. New York is the top metro for Allergy Physician by raw provider count, which tracks population density more than any state-specific licensure pattern — the taxonomy is recognized nationwide through NUCC, not state-by-state.
